hur.cn - 华软网

 热门搜索

关于 CryptUnprotectData 函数的使用问题

  作者:未知    来源:网络    更新时间:2010/12/5
直接在vc下编译说没定义,装上SDK后 又出现
error LNK2001: unresolved external symbol "int __stdcall CryptUnprotectData(struct _CRYPTOAPI_BLOB *,unsigned short * *,struct _CRYPTOAPI_BLOB *,void *,struct _CRYPTPROTECT_PROMPTSTRUCT *,unsigned long,struct _CRYPTOAPI_BLOB *)" (?C
ryptUnprotectData@@YGHPAU_CRYPTOAPI_BLOB@@PAPAG0PAXPAU_CRYPTPROTECT_PROMPTSTRUCT@@K0@Z)
Debug/Get IE7 PW.exe : fatal error LNK1120: 1 unresolved externals

实际上我是在编译 http://wangruwei.blog.51cto.com/186868/151102 中的c++ 版本,花了很大力气总是有错,希望列位大虾不吝见教啊,要是能够提供一个能还原IE7(8) 保存密码的代码更好(一定编译通过啊)
---华软 网友回答---
莫不是我的dll或是lib版本的问题?
---华软网友回复---
lnk2001,没找到函数实现,看看资料是否加入工程中,或.lib是否加入工程中,或函数声明与函数体是否完全一致。

---华软网友回复---
lib资料加入 工程了,而且 函数声明没错啊  msdn 都是这么写的
以前遇到这类毛病直接谷歌就搜出解决措施了   但此次没有啊
函数声明与函数体不一致会报这个错么?
就是详细针对这个函数我搞大概
---华软网友回复---
函数申明和函数体不一致肯定不行啊.你详细怎么写的啊?
---华软网友回复---
麻烦大哥将  http://wangruwei.blog.51cto.com/186868/151102  中的c++ 版本编译一下吧,先谢谢啦
我就是编译成功不了
---华软网友回复---
找找lib资料。      
华软声明:本内容来自网络,如有侵犯您版权请来信指出,本站立即删除。